7+ Toyota Wheel Torque Chart Specs & Guide

toyota wheel torque chart

7+ Toyota Wheel Torque Chart Specs & Guide

Defined as a specification detailing the appropriate tightness for securing a vehicle’s wheels, this information is crucial for safe vehicle operation. The data typically includes the recommended force, measured in foot-pounds (ft-lbs) or Newton-meters (Nm), to which the wheel nuts or bolts should be tightened. For instance, a typical passenger car might require a setting of 80 ft-lbs, while a larger truck or SUV may need a higher value.

Adhering to the designated tightness values is paramount for several reasons. Insufficient torque can lead to the wheel loosening during driving, potentially causing catastrophic wheel separation and accidents. Conversely, excessive force can stretch or damage the wheel studs or bolts, reducing their strength and increasing the risk of failure. Consistent application of the correct value ensures uniform clamping force, minimizing vibration and promoting even wear on brake rotors and other components. Historically, mechanics relied on experience to judge appropriate tightness, but modern standards and easily accessible data have made precise application achievable for professionals and DIYers alike.

Find 2009 Camry Wheel Bolt Pattern + Guide

2009 toyota camry wheel bolt pattern

Find 2009 Camry Wheel Bolt Pattern + Guide

The specification indicates the configuration of the mounting holes on a vehicle’s wheel hub and the corresponding wheel. For the 2009 Toyota Camry, this specification is 5×114.3mm (or 5×4.5 inches). This means that the wheel has five lug holes, and these holes are positioned on a circle with a diameter of 114.3 millimeters (or 4.5 inches). This measurement is critical for ensuring proper wheel fitment.

Correct wheel fitment, dictated by this specification, is crucial for vehicle safety and performance. Using wheels with an incorrect configuration can lead to wheel instability, damage to the vehicle’s wheel bearings and suspension components, and potential wheel detachment while driving. Historically, standardization of these measurements has evolved to ensure compatibility and safety across various vehicle makes and models. Adherence to this specification also ensures compatibility with a wide range of aftermarket wheel options.

7+ Toyota Camry Wheel Nut Torque: Proper Tightening!

toyota camry wheel nut torque

7+ Toyota Camry Wheel Nut Torque: Proper Tightening!

The specified tightness with which the fasteners securing a road wheel to a Toyota Camry’s hub should be tightened is a critical parameter. This parameter, typically measured in foot-pounds (ft-lbs) or Newton-meters (Nm), ensures the wheel is safely and securely attached. Applying the correct force prevents the wheel from detaching while the vehicle is in motion and avoids damage to the wheel studs or the wheel itself. For instance, if the manufacturer specifies 80 ft-lbs, each fastener should be tightened to that precise value.

Adherence to the recommended specification is vital for vehicle safety and component longevity. Insufficient tightness can lead to wheel loosening, vibration, and potentially catastrophic wheel separation. Over-tightening, conversely, can stretch or break the wheel studs, warp the brake rotor, or damage the wheel. Historically, relying on imprecise methods like “feel” led to frequent issues. The adoption of torque wrenches and adherence to manufacturer specifications has greatly reduced wheel-related incidents.
